LinedFlowLayout.MinItemSpacing 属性

定义

获取或设置水平轴上项之间的最小间距。

public:
 property double MinItemSpacing { double get(); void set(double value); };
/// [get: Microsoft.UI.Xaml.CustomAttributes.MUXPropertyDefaultValue(value="LinedFlowLayout::s_defaultMinItemSpacing")]
/// [set: Microsoft.UI.Xaml.CustomAttributes.MUXPropertyDefaultValue(value="LinedFlowLayout::s_defaultMinItemSpacing")]
double MinItemSpacing();

void MinItemSpacing(double value);
/// [Microsoft.UI.Xaml.CustomAttributes.MUXPropertyDefaultValue(value="LinedFlowLayout::s_defaultMinItemSpacing")]
/// [get: Microsoft.UI.Xaml.CustomAttributes.MUXPropertyDefaultValue(value="LinedFlowLayout::s_defaultMinItemSpacing")]
/// [set: Microsoft.UI.Xaml.CustomAttributes.MUXPropertyDefaultValue(value="LinedFlowLayout::s_defaultMinItemSpacing")]
double MinItemSpacing();

void MinItemSpacing(double value);
public double MinItemSpacing { [Microsoft.UI.Xaml.CustomAttributes.MUXPropertyDefaultValue(value="LinedFlowLayout::s_defaultMinItemSpacing")] get; [Microsoft.UI.Xaml.CustomAttributes.MUXPropertyDefaultValue(value="LinedFlowLayout::s_defaultMinItemSpacing")] set; }
[Microsoft.UI.Xaml.CustomAttributes.MUXPropertyDefaultValue(value="LinedFlowLayout::s_defaultMinItemSpacing")]
public double MinItemSpacing { [Microsoft.UI.Xaml.CustomAttributes.MUXPropertyDefaultValue(value="LinedFlowLayout::s_defaultMinItemSpacing")] get; [Microsoft.UI.Xaml.CustomAttributes.MUXPropertyDefaultValue(value="LinedFlowLayout::s_defaultMinItemSpacing")] set; }
var double = linedFlowLayout.minItemSpacing;
linedFlowLayout.minItemSpacing = double;
Public Property MinItemSpacing As Double

属性值

Double

double

水平轴上的项目之间) 最小 (像素的空间。 默认值为 0.0。

属性
Microsoft.UI.Xaml.CustomAttributes.MUXPropertyDefaultValueAttribute

示例

<ItemsView ItemsSource="{x:Bind Photos}">
    <ItemsView.Layout>
        <LinedFlowLayout MinItemSpacing="6"/>
    </ItemsView.Layout>
</ItemsView>

注解

ItemsStretch 设置为 且 ItemsJustificationSpaceEvenly设置为 None 、 或 SpaceBetween时,SpaceAround间距可能会超过此最小值。

适用于